2.1 Vineyards and Wineries
Famous for their picturesque settings and exceptional landscapes, vineyards and wineries are among the most popular wedding venues in northern California. Imagine saying your vows surrounded by rows of lush grapevines, followed by a glamorous reception in a rustic barrel room. Generally equipped with facilities to accommodate both the ceremony and reception, many wineries also offer in-house catering featuring local wines and farm-to-table cuisine, enhancing the overall experience for you and your guests.
2.2 Beachfront Locations
For couples drawn to the ocean, the beachfront venues of northern California provide a tranquil yet dynamic backdrop. From intimate gatherings on sandy shores to grand celebrations overlooking the Pacific, there are various options to satisfy every bride and groom’s vision. Sunset ceremonies can be breathtakingly beautiful, with the sun dipping below the horizon creating a magical atmosphere perfect for weddings. Special considerations for beachfront venues may include tides, legal regulations, and potential weather challenges, so be sure to inquire about these aspects when selecting a site.
2.3 Rustic Barns and Farms
The rustic charm of barns and farms appeals to many couples looking for a cozy, intimate setting. Northern California boasts numerous well-preserved barns that have been transformed into stylish venues, blending modern amenities with old-world charm. These venues allow for personalization, often enabling couples to incorporate decor that reflects their style and story. Add in the backdrop of the countryside, and you have a setting that feels both down-to-earth and enchanting, perfect for a celebration with close family and friends.

4.1 Seasonal Trends and Popular Dates
Nailing down the date can be a challenging decision. It’s important to recognize the seasonal trends typical for weddings in northern California. Spring and fall generally present the most favorable weather for outdoor venues, leading to higher demand and potentially limited availability. Research calendar trends to secure a venue on your preferred date. Flexibility with wedding dates can sometimes yield better venue options as venues often have various pricing tiers based on peak and off-peak seasons.

5.1 What is the average cost of a wedding venue in northern California?
The average cost of wedding venues in northern California can vary significantly depending on the location, capacity, and amenities offered. Generally, prices can range from $3,000 to over $20,000, so it’s advisable to research different options and establish a budget early on.
5.2 How do I secure a venue booking?
To secure a venue, first check its availability for your preferred date. Many venues require a deposit and a signed contract to officially book your date. It’s prudent to read and understand all terms and conditions to avoid surprises later.
5.3 Are there all-inclusive packages available?
Many northern California wedding venues offer all-inclusive packages, including services like catering, decoration, and coordination. These can simplify planning and often provide cost savings. Be sure to inquire about what is included in such packages when considering your venue options.
